Subject: DR drill — Sproutly scheduler, Thursday

Plugin authors: on Thursday we will simulate a full outage of the Sproutly watering scheduler. Expect the plugin API to return failover responses for roughly two hours. Please verify your plugins degrade gracefully and log reconnect attempts. To re-authenticate against the standby environment during the drill, use the recovery passphrase below.

strongbox words: gilok-druion-briath-wendor-briion-prawyn-fenion-oliir-casdor-holius-briius-gilath-gilael-pelys

Quick security note before you dig into the retry flow: every charge request through Ledgewick carries an idempotency key, generated client-side and stored for 72 hours. If a retry lands with the same key, we return the cached result instead of double-charging anyone. Keys are UUIDv4, scoped per merchant, and rejected if reused with a different payload — that mismatch triggers an alert you'll want to review. To poke at the retry sandbox yourself, authenticate against the Ledgewick staging gateway with the key below.

gateway credential: kto23_LX9A4ys6i4nzHtpOLNLodKK

## Formula sandbox tuning

User-supplied formulas in Gridmoor execute inside a restricted interpreter with hard ceilings on time, memory, and call depth. Reviewers should confirm any change to these ceilings is justified in the PR description, since raising them widens the abuse surface. Defaults were chosen from production traces. The current limits are as follows.

limits module of tafog-fawip:
WEIGHTS = {
    "julix": 57,
    "lamys": 992,
    "kasvan": 209,
    "quenok": 750,
    "alddor": 259,
    "oliath": 1009,
    "wenix": 815,
}

Subject: Quickstore 4.2 — bloom filter now fronts the KV layer

Plugin authors: starting with this release, Quickstore places a bloom filter ahead of the key-value store. Negative lookups return faster; false positives fall through safely. No API changes are required on your side. Verify your plugin against the staging build referenced below.

session token of fahif-tadup = htk3_9c7